Community input regarding new construction for a school at the Wilson Site
Last December the Arlington County School Board approved construction for a new school at the Wilson School Site. Arlington Public Schools has set up a "Building Level Planning Committee" and Arlington County has a "Public Facilities Review Committee", both of which provide input into the process of making the new school a reality. Since the Wilson School site is located within the North Rosslyn boundaries, the North Rosslyn Civic Association is allowed two representatives.

Carroll Colley and Paul Mulligan have both volunteered to represent the North Rosslyn community on these two key planning committees.

Your input to Carroll and Paul is welcomed and encouraged in shaping the new school. You may post your ideas and comments as responses to this discussion and Carroll and Paul along with your neighbors will receive your ideas. Carroll and Paul will post what they learn and what areas they need input here on this forum.
